Bespoke web development and design that they'll remember

Contact for pricing

About this service

Summary

My approach to web development involves harnessing the power of Next.js, Tailwind CSS, React, and React Three Fiber to build bespoke websites that not only reflect the individuality of each client but also incorporate modern design trends and interactive features for an exceptional online presence.

Process

Initial Consultation:Begin with a thorough discussion to understand the client's business, goals, and specific requirements. This includes identifying the target audience, desired functionalities, and any design preferences.
Scope Definition:Collaboratively outline the project scope, specifying features, deliverables, and timelines. Clearly define the roles and responsibilities of both parties, ensuring alignment on expectations.
Proposal and Agreement:Present a detailed proposal, including the project scope, timeline, cost estimate, and any terms and conditions. Once both parties agree, formalize the arrangement with a signed contract.
Design and Planning:Initiate the design phase, creating wireframes or prototypes to visualize the website's structure and layout. Discuss design elements, color schemes, and any other aesthetic preferences with the client.
Development:Begin the development process using Next.js, Tailwind CSS, React, and React Three Fiber. Provide regular updates to the client, allowing them to review the progress and make any necessary adjustments.
Testing:Rigorously test the website for functionality, responsiveness, and compatibility across different devices and browsers. Address any bugs or issues that arise during this phase.
Client Review:Invite the client to review the developed website and provide feedback. Make necessary revisions based on their input to ensure the final product aligns with their vision and requirements.
Deployment:Once the client approves the final version, deploy the website to the live server. Configure any necessary hosting services and ensure the website is accessible to the intended audience.
Training and Handover:If applicable, provide training sessions to the client on managing and updating the website. Transfer any relevant credentials and documentation for their future reference.
Post-Launch Support:Offer ongoing support for any post-launch issues, updates, or additional features. Establish a communication plan for addressing future needs and maintaining a positive client-developer relationship.

FAQs

  • 1. How long does the web development process typically take?

    The timeline varies depending on the project's complexity and scope. A simple website might take a few weeks, while a more intricate one with advanced features could take several months

  • 2. What information do you need from us to start the project?

    I'll need a comprehensive overview of your business, target audience, specific functionalities you require, and any design preferences you may have. Access to existing branding materials and content is also beneficial.

  • 3. Can you provide examples of websites you've developed using Next.js, Tailwind CSS, React, and React Three Fiber?

    Certainly, I can share a portfolio showcasing previous projects that highlight the diverse applications and features of these technologies.

  • 4. How do you handle revisions during the development process?

    I encourage open communication and collaboration. We'll have regular check-ins and milestones for your feedback, and I'll incorporate any necessary revisions to ensure the final product aligns with your expectations.

  • 5. What measures do you take to ensure the website is responsive and accessible on different devices and browsers?

    I employ responsive design principles and conduct thorough testing across various devices and browsers to ensure optimal performance and accessibility.

  • 6. What level of involvement is expected from us during the development process?

    Your input is crucial. I'll need your feedback on design elements, content, and overall functionality. Regular check-ins and timely responses to queries will help keep the project on track.

  • 7. How is website maintenance handled after the launch?

    I can provide ongoing support for updates, bug fixes, and additional features. We can discuss a maintenance plan or training sessions for your team to manage routine updates.

  • 8. What hosting options do you recommend, and can you assist with the setup?

    I can recommend suitable hosting options based on your needs and assist with the setup. Whether it's a traditional web host or a cloud-based solution, we'll find the best fit for your project.

  • 9. How do you ensure the security of the website and its users?

    Security is a priority. I implement best practices, such as secure coding, data encryption, and regular updates to frameworks and plugins, to safeguard the website and user data.

  • 10. What happens if we encounter issues with the website after it's launched?

    I provide post-launch support to address any issues promptly. We can discuss a support plan tailored to your needs, ensuring a smooth transition and ongoing satisfaction with the website.

What's included

  • Custom Website

    Custom website, front to back, if you need hosting or getting it hosted or need web administration that can be discussed as well

  • Custom 3D assets

    If so chosen, custom 3D assets made specifically for you or your business


Skills and tools

Frontend Engineer
Fullstack Engineer
Software Engineer
JavaScript
Next.js
React
Tailwind CSS
three.js

Industries

Web Apps
Web Development
Small and Medium Businesses

Work with me


More services